Psyllium Husk is the outer layer of Psyllium Seeds, obtained through advanced cleaning and milling processes. It is highly valued for its ability to absorb water and form a gel-like consistency, making it one of the most widely used natural dietary fiber ingredients in the world.
Due to its excellent functional properties, Psyllium Husk is extensively utilized in digestive health products, fiber supplements, gluten-free foods, pharmaceutical formulations, and industrial applications.
